Need your advice - asked to co-instruct/lead S130 field day! by Civil_Firefighter648 in Firefighting

[–]Competitive_March_35 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Volly firefighter who had a similar training, things I wish I learned/did more of. 1 deploying hose from a smokey pack and making those connections, do many reps, maybe throw in "hidden hot spots" that would burn up the line. 2 we didnt have the conditions for a live fire practice but if thats something you can do get them comfortable being up against it, first fire i saw was a wall of flames from standing wheat coming towards me, felt small with my 1" hose compared to my structure line. 3 situational awareness and communication, call out the roots, low hangs, hot spots, play telephone up and down the line.

Building a Probationary FF Fireground Training Book by Mindless_Pie7278 in Firefighting

[–]Competitive_March_35 -1 points0 points  (0 children)

Once you complete it and if your department likes it(and if you enjoyed the process) you should look into working with training officers and other departments to help them edit their training books. could be a good side hussle and training is always evolving.

Rookie firefighter in a mixed volunteer/career department: went through a volunteer, county wide academy and everything taught there fell back on "your department will teach you" so didnt learn much. had to make alot of effort to teach myself(still teaching myself a year later to prepare for a career position) I encourage adding sign off lists after each bundle of skills that extend what is in a task book if your state has those. We only had sign offs on a list of knots, but being a volunteer I wish our training book was alive, constantly being studied and that you could build drills out of. Secondly I was constantly told "theres a million ways to do things" maybe adding the top 3-5 methods. My favorite is folks talking about ladders, get the tall guy, the short guy, and a gal to throw a ladder and note how they do it helps more than being told "heres the one way" or told "you'll learn your way". The top skills I wish I practiced more were ladders(especially 3 part ladders) pulling hose inside a structure(up stairs/around corners, moving backwards) and active tool usage (didnt pull a ceiling or cut into walls until I was on a active fire)
